Webb19 nov. 2024 · Hardy Eucalyptus recommends dwarf cider gum varieties like ‘France Bleu’, ‘Azura’ and ‘Silverana’. These are all slow-growing with a compact bushy habit that's perfect for creating a hedge for garden privacy. E. fastigata often has relatively slow early growth, but it is a stayer, and capable of carrying higher volumes/ha than most other eucalypts. It will tolerate heavy soils of moderate fertility, and most provenances will tolerate frosts of -12°C. Correct. Plant range. Tasmania. grand strand schedulingWebb13 okt. 2024 · Eucalyptus coccifera- Endemic to Tasmania's central and southern mountains. At high altitude it can be quite stunted, reaching greater heights in valleys. Prefers a light to medium moist soil in an open sunny position, frost and snow resistant.
